Appointments at the Covéa Group

Arthur Dénouveaux has been appointed Chief Transformation Officer within the Insurance France department. At the same time, he will continue to serve as Chief of Staff to Stéphane Duroule, Chief Insurance Officer France. The Transformation Management department will consolidate the running and coordination of major transformation projects concerning the Insurance France department.

Aurélie Lagré has been appointed Chief Data Officer and Director of Data Transformation and Performance within the Offers and Services department, reporting to Valérie Cohen, and has also taken on the role of Chief Data Officer for the Insurance France department.

Jérôme Lamoureux has been appointed Chief Performance and Purchasing Strategy Officer within the Sustainability and Transformation Finance department, reporting to Aude Messin. He will take up his duties on 1 March 2024.

Priscilla Cournède has been appointed Director of Economic Affairs within the Regulatory and Economic Affafirs department, reporting to Thierry Francq.

Biographies

Arthur Dénouveaux holds degrees from the Ecole Polytechnique, the Ecole Nationale de la Statistique et de l’Administration Economique and Université Paris Dauphine - PSL.

Having spent his early career in quantitative finance at Société Générale, he co-founded and became Managing Partner of Machina Capital, an innovative fund management company that received the Finance Innovation label in 2017.

He joined MMA as Chief Innovation Officer in January 2021 and, while remaining in this role, also became Director of Covéa Affinity in September 2021.

He is also chair of the charity Life for Paris to help victims of the Paris attacks of 13 November 2015, and has written essays for publishers Gallimard, L’Aube and La Martinière. In 2019, he was awarded the prestigious French honour of "Chevalier de l'Ordre National du Mérite”.

Arthur Dénouveaux has been Chief of Staff to Covéa’s Chief Insurance Officer France since January 2023.

Aurélie Lagré is an actuary who studied at the Institut de Science Financière at d’Assurances (ISFA).

Before joining Covéa, she began her career as an actuary in the Life Insurance and Banking Technical department at Axa France.

She joined the Group in 2007 as an actuary at MAAF, before taking on a variety of roles in relation to Solvency II. In 2017, she became Group Head of Prudential Central Actuarial and Actuarial.

In February 2021, Aurélie Lagré was made Chief Transformation and Economic Performance Officer within the Offers and Services department.

Jérôme Lamoureux studied at the Saint-Cyr French national military academy and ESSEC business school. He began his career in 2001 at Air France-KLM as Head of International Procurement, becoming deputy route manager in 2004.

In 2008, he joined Fidélia Assistance as Head of Payments and Service Provider Networks.

He was appointed Head of Motor Insurance and Assistance within the Networks and Partnerships department at Covéa AIS in 2016.

In 2018, Jérôme Lamoureux became Director of Assistance and Deputy CEO of Fidélia Assistance, as well as being a member of the management committee.

Priscilla Cournède studied at the Ecole Polytechnique and the Ecole Nationale de la Statistique et de l’Administration Economique, holds a certificate in business administration from Sciences Po and the Institut Français des Administrateurs, and is a certified member of the Institut des Actuaires.

She joined Covéa in 2020 as project manager, in charge of strategic projects within the Technology and IT Systems department.

From 2021 to 2023, Priscilla Cournède was Chief Transformation Officer within the Transformation and International Activities department, helping all the Group’s brands with their transformations in relation to data, digital technology and artificial intelligence, and management of investment to support the Group’s transformation.

Before joining Covéa in 2020, Priscilla worked for public and private organisations including SCOR, Mercer HRC, OECD and Société Générale in a variety of roles, primarily in the area of insurance and reinsurance, capitalising on her skills as an economist, statistician, actuary and project manager.
